Output 578672ce6126e93056e3c004957af4293a85339bba869eef47598bd626838460:1

value
169835420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2b39fb521ac1ecc14eb43c748cd2bb243e6fc7c OP_EQUAL
address
3PpJdT7tG5McT2yuKuK62e4EhfZdzppmkH
transaction
578672ce6126e93056e3c004957af4293a85339bba869eef47598bd626838460
spent
true